Irma Boom: The Architecture of the Book

$350.00

Publisher ‏ : ‎ Lecturis (October 30, 2013)

Design Irma Boom
Language ‏ : ‎ English
Paperback ‏ : ‎ 800 pages
ISBN-10 ‏ : ‎ 9462260354
ISBN-13 ‏ : ‎ 978-9462260351
Dimensions ‏ : ‎ 4.45 x 1.26 x 6.02 inches

Irma Boom has become one of the most widely renowned and laureated book designers in the world today. Her often ingenious solutions to individual book productions have gained her international fame and her work is now collected by many leading museums such as the MoMa in New York. Besides book designs she also creates corporate identities, postage stamps and posters. The Special Collections of the University of Amsterdam Library honoured Irma Boom with a major retrospective exhibition of her work, now traveling to Paris. To accompany this exhibition she produced an exceptional catalogue; this miniature book contains a complete overview of her work, now re-printed in a slightly bigger version and with more pages.
